Business Intelligence (BI) Developer

We are looking for an enthusiastic individual to build their career within our IT Department as a Business Intelligence Developer, responsible for the design, development, and documentation of database solutions. This position requires the ability to complete complex development efforts using an agile development methodology.
Reporting to Head – Business Intelligence Unit, the developer will be responsible for detailed analysis, design, and development of business intelligence systems, dashboards, and reports. Additionally, he/she will be required to maintain and support applications within this section and will therefore be required to have knowledge working within the agile methodology keeping in mind quality control plans within the developments to identify improvements.
The role
The successful jobholder will be expected to:

Develop and implement business intelligence reports, dashboards, and other solutions that ensure business optimization and requirements fulfillment. 
Analyze business/use case requirements from BI analysts to determine operational problems, define data modeling requirements, gather and validate information, apply judgment and statistical tests and develop data structures to support the generation of business insights and strategy.
Filter, “clean” data, and review reports, printouts, and performance indicators to locate and correct code problems;
Identify, analyze, and interpret trends or patterns in complex data sets as well as interpret the data and analyze results using statistical techniques and provide ongoing reports.
Acquire data from primary or secondary data sources and maintain databases/data systems.
Design and code reports/dashboards according to user specifications with the key objective of delivering reports that will assist in decision-making and control. 
Make changes to system configuration and parameters to accommodate business and technological requirements.
Provide test interfaces for users to test the reports and dashboards before being put on the production environment.
Develop and maintain documentation/manuals on system configuration or setup and deal with queries from users and resolve or advise.
Locate and define new business and technological process improvement opportunities.
Carry-out analysis of requirements and recommend solutions to address user requirements as well as attend to systems/solution failures and resolve or coordinate the resolution of the problem.
Develop and maintain documentation/manuals on system configuration or setup in addition to building reusable code and libraries for future use.
Assist in developing and implementing a program of continuous improvement of BI processes through a cycle of analysis of existing systems, processes, and tools, identifying areas for improvement, implementing high-impact changes, and getting feedback from stakeholders. 
Understand key performance measures and Indicators that drive company performance measurement, reporting, and analytics across functions and understand how these metrics and measures align and track against overall business strategies, goals, and objectives. 
Roll out business intelligence solutions to stakeholders and provide test systems for UAT to ensure that functions/features are tested before go-live.
Secure systems by putting adequate controls and restricting access to programs by users in accordance with the requirements of the bank.
Strict adherence to all regulations, statutes, standards, practices, and all internal processes and procedures as per the relevant manuals and compliance with all relevant external legislation and regulations with regard to compliance requirements.

Qualifications, Skills & Attributes
The successful jobholder will be required to possess the following qualifications: –

Bachelor of Science Degree in Computer Science or related degree from a recognized university with experience in software development knowledge.
Minimum 3 years experience in software development, data analysis, and reporting with a proven record of accomplishment.
Very strong analytical, presentation & problem-solving skills with the ability to work confidently on high-priority problems and present technical ideas in a user-friendly language.
Technical expertise in warehouse design, dimensional modeling, and data mining techniques.
Strong knowledge of and experience with ETL tools (Oracle ODI, Microsoft SSIS, Talend), query languages(Oracle PL/SQL, SQL), visualization tools (OBIEE, Admin tool, Power BI, SSRS, Tableau, click view)
Working knowledge of databases (Oracle, SQL server)
Fair knowledge of programming (Java, C#, Python)
Very good knowledge of Windows Operating Systems and a fair knowledge of Unix and Linux.

If you are confident that you fit the role and person profile and you are keen to add value to your career then please forward your application enclosing detailed Curriculum Vitae to jobs@co-opbank.co.ke indicating the job reference number BID/IID/2023 by 18th January 2023.

Apply via :

jobs@co-opbank.co.ke